These toolkits include background information about Medicaid/CHIP enrollment, the Medicaid unwinding, and Affordable Care Act (ACA) … WebDec 15, 2024 · The Children's Health Insurance Program (CHIP) helps kids get the services they need to stay healthy, including: Dentist visits, cleanings, and fillings. Eye exams and glasses. Choice of doctors, regular checkups, and office visits. Prescription drugs and vaccines. Access to medical specialists and mental health care. Hospital care …

WebThe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) recently established 12 new Medicaid and CHIP eligibility and enrollment performance indicators for states to report beginning in October 2013. These indicators provide insight into the performance of new eligibility and enrollment policies established under the Affordable Care Act (ACA).
